1 Explain the differences between the positions of president and prime minister

... First, the president is much weaker in terms of power than a prime minister. ... The president’s political party rarely holds a majority in Congress; therefore, his suggested policies are usually unapproved by Congress. It is extremely difficult for the President to get his legislation passed as a result. In a parliamentary system of government, the prime minister always has the majority in the Parliament; otherwise, he would not hold office.
